Ingredients for Cozy Autumn One-Pot Stew

You’ll need a mix of seasonal staples for this hearty stew. Here’s the lineup:

  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 medium carrots, sliced
  • 2 parsnips, peeled and sliced (or use more carrots)
  • 1 sweet potato, peeled and cubed
  • 1 can (15 oz) cannellini beans, drained and rinsed (or chickpeas)
  • 4 cups vegetable broth (low-sodium works great)
  • 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es
  • 1 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1 tsp dried thyme (or 2 sprigs fresh thyme)
  • ½ tsp ground cinnamon (for a cozy twist)
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• 2 cups kale or spinach, roughly chopped
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(optional, for garnish)

Swap in your favorite fall veggies—this stew loves variety!


How to Make Cozy Autumn One-Pot Stew

This recipe is as easy as it gets—just toss everything in and let it simmer. Here’s how:

  1. Sauté the Base: Heat olive oil in a large pot or Dutch oven over medium heat. Add the onion and cook for 3-4 minutes until softened. Stir in the garlic and cook for another minute until fragrant.
  2. Add the Veggies: Toss in the carrots, parsnips, and sweet potato. Stir to coat in the oil and cook for 2-3 minutes.
  3. Season and Simmer: Add the beans, vegetable broth, diced tomatoes, smoked paprika, thyme, cinnamon, salt, and pepper. Stir well, bring to a boil, then reduce to a simmer. Cover and cook for 25-30 minutes, until the veggies are tender.
  4. Finish with Greens: Stir in the kale or spinach and cook for another 3-5 minutes until wilted.
  5. Serve: Taste and adjust seasoning if needed. Ladle into bowls, sprinkle with parsley if desired, and enjoy warm with crusty bread or on its own!

Tips for the Best Autumn Stew

Want to make it perfect? Try these pointers:

  • Thicken It Up: Mash a few pieces of sweet potato or add a slurry of 1 tsp cornstarch and water for a heartier texture.
  • Boost Flavor: Add a splash of apple cider vinegar or a bay leaf during simmering for extra depth.
  • Slow Cooker Option: Toss everything (except greens) into a slow cooker and c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ours. Add greens 20 minutes before serving.

Store leftovers in the fridge for up to 5 days or freeze for up to 3 months. Reheat with a splash of broth to bring back that stew magic!


Customize Your Autumn Stew

Love a twist? Here’s how to personalize it:

  • Protein Boost: Add cooked sausage, shredded chicken, or lentils for extra heartiness.
  • Spicy Kick: Toss in a pinch of red pepper flakes or a chopped chili for warmth.
  • Veggie Swap: Try butternut squash, turnips, or mushrooms for a different fall flair.
